Transaction 826c5e3907cf07d0f3887ce3f39397c8dffade555ef5e76c99aa5c3b1fbdf23b
1 Input
1 Output
-
826c5e3907cf07d0f3887ce3f39397c8dffade555ef5e76c99aa5c3b1fbdf23b:0
- value
- 152624
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d60bb695a9734209590a86aff05823674ae7e5ad OP_EQUAL
- address
- 3MCnZSj1EjhQEAiWrSocFyVCAh6LeJ9t99